High-speed, high-resolution piezo Z-focusing stage supporting live cell observation.
In the fields of life sciences and biotechnology, stable focusing during microscopic observation greatly affects the reproducibility of acquired data and the accuracy of analysis. Particularly in live cell imaging and 3D observation, high-speed and high-resolution Z-axis control is required.
The P-737 PIFOC Z stage employs a piezo-flexure mechanism that directly drives the objective lens, achieving high-speed Z positioning with nanometer resolution. Depending on the model, it can secure sufficient stroke length, making it suitable for Z-stack acquisition and long-duration observations. Its compact design also allows for easy integration into existing microscope systems.
